Output 53f903691fbe23232694cb5c1317bceaac18e09c0d17057d7361236f93bb6f67:4

value
184442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 843ae2c68ae565495f26e79bdfd22482e012fdcf OP_EQUALVERIFY OP_CHECKSIG
address
1D4AjnLTi3TwaWou6RVaLW8P71h2nH2jKX
transaction
53f903691fbe23232694cb5c1317bceaac18e09c0d17057d7361236f93bb6f67
confirmations
369089
spent
true